What are the 2 major segments of skeleton?
The axial skeleton consists of the bones that form the central axis of the body, including:
- The skull
- The vertebral column
- The sternum
- The ribcage
2. Appendicular skeleton
The appendicular skeleton consists of the bones that form the limbs and the bones that connect the limbs to the axial skeleton, including:
- The shoulder girdle
- The upper limbs (arms and hands)
- The pelvic girdle
- The lower limbs (legs and feet)
